In 1752, Jeremiah Smith entered the world in Tuckahoe, Cape May, New Jersey, USA, born to Jeremiah Smith and Abigail Smith. Years later, Jeremiah Smith married Naomi Babcock, and the couple became parents to Lydia Smith, Jeremiah Smith and James Smith. Jeremiah Smith died in 1831 in Tuckahoe, Cape May, New Jersey, USA.
